The Digital Circus is nowhere in view, as the only thing to be seen even remotely close is a lit computer screen. At the computer, there sits a man in rather business attire typing away, bags under his eyes and unkempt brown hair match his five o'clock shadow as he types away before speaking.
Man: You sure this is an ACTUAL lead this time, Rhodes? We've had some before, but they all lead to bupkis.
Just then, a woman speaks up, this one's voice being one we've heard before as now we finally have a face to the voice. The voice now came from a tall and curved, even slightly rounded, Spanish woman. Her tan skin coinciding well with her long black hair, onyx gray eyes, and her detective wear of a dress shirt and skirt bottom.
Rhodes: I'm telling you, it's real! Look at the message here, that picture is too realistic to JUST be a drawing. It looks like a damn photograph!
Man: Really?... A 3D CARTOON jester girl looks realistic to you? You've been drinking too much again?
Rhodes: Look, Cosgrove, I know we've had our fair share of disputes, but I'm close to something. I know it and even you know it. Corporate doesn't even know we're doing this! I mean, why even agree to help if you didn't trust me?
Cosgrove: Cus I'm saddled with you, idiot. Plus, those ingrates back at HQ were wasting my talents with... *gags* tech support.
Rhodes: Look, play the apathy card all you want, but these C&A assholes have been swarming around and giving you guys a bad name ever since the 90's with this Circus game! Just... If the rumors really ARE true, if there really ARE people trapped in that game... I need to help them. Please?
The man stares at the desperate woman before he sighs defeatedly. He mumbles something incoherent as he reaches into a drawer of the desk he's seated at and pulls out a VR headset.
Cosgrove: Here. Before I change my mind.
Rhodes: The Super View! Aren't these the headsets that's supposed to put me in a coma?
Cosgrove: Yes, but this is a different circumstance. I took some time to analyze what exactly is wrong with the headset and why it did the things it did. Now with my modifications, you may be comatose, but I also added a 2 way communication chat to the avatar I custom made for you so I can speak with you. You should be able to keep a sound mind AND if things get too intense, I can easily pull you out back to reality. You'll be like a player character in the eyes of the game.
Rhodes: Woah. I... Never knew you could do this.
Cosgrove: There's a lot you don't know about me, Frida. Now, unless something goes VERY wrong, you'll be in the game for a while. You sure you wanna go through with this?
Rhodes: ...Not really. But SOMEONE has to help.
The woman then sits down in a nearby chair in the small cramped room they had hunkered themselves in. Rhodes lets out a breath as she slips the headset on her face, her vision being fully encompassed by a familiar start screen as chipper, bit-tune music plays.
